Job Title: Corporate Finance Manager

Location: Lagos
Employment Type: Full-time

Job Description

  • The Corporate Finance Manager, will be responsible for overseeing the organization’s financial planning, analysis, and capital management to ensure sustainable growth and profitability.
  • Success in this role means delivering accurate financial insights, optimizing resource allocation, and supporting strategic decision-making.
  • This role is pivotal in driving financial excellence and aligning financial strategies with the company’s overall objectives.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ement financial planning processes, including budgeting, forecasting, and financial modeling to support organizational decision-making.
  • Analyze key financial metrics and performance indicators, providing actionable insights and recommendations to senior leadership.
  • Lead the evaluation of investment opportunities, capital projects, and other strategic initiatives to maximize return on investment.
  • Manage cash flow, capital structure, and working capital to ensure optimal liquidity and financial stability.
  • Prepare and present detailed financial reports, projections, and scenarios to internal stakeholders, including executive leadership and board members.
  • Oversee compliance with financial regulations, company policies, and industry standards in all financial activities.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to align financial strategies with business goals and support organizational growth.
  • Identify and implement process improvements and tools to enhance financial analysis, reporting, and efficiency.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or a related field.
  • 8 -12 years of experience in corporate finance, financial planning & analysis, or related roles.
  •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A), Certified Public Accountant (CPA), or equivalent is an addition.
  • Proven track record of driving financial strategy and improving operational efficiency.
  • Advanced proficiency in financial modeling and forecasting tools (e.g., Excel, Power BI, or Tableau).
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ities with a strategic mindset.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to present complex financial data effectively.
